The second annual women's rowing Beanpot went again to Radcliffe by a solid two-boat length victory.
The Cliffies covered the 2000-meter Charles River course in 6:24.0 to NU's 6:31.4. BU was third at 6:38.7, BC 6:56.9 and MIT 7:05.2.
Radcliffe established a half-length lead over the Huskies at the 500 meter mark. Even at this early stage of the race, these two shells had cleared BU, BC and MIT. Radcliffe, the fourth seeded Eastern Sprint crew, opened their lead to eight seats at 1000, then gained open water on fifth seeded NU at 1500.
Within the Beanpot, the Jeanne Rowlands Cup versus Radcliffe was contested with the Cliffies extending their Cup lead to 21-4 and the annual BU race, which was won by NU, narrows the series to 19 for BU and 8 for NU.
The Huskies, now 12-2, will row Columbia in the Woodbury Cup at Orchard Beach Lagoon Sunday at 10:30 a.m.
Varsity: Radcliffe 6:24.0; NU 6:31.4; BU 6:38.7; BC 6:56.9; MIT 7:05.2
2nd Varsity: Radcliffe 6:42.6; BU 6:55.1; NU 7:01.4; BC 7:15.9
Varsity 4: Radcliffe 7:32.2; BU 7:33.0; NU 7:49.3; MIT 8:16.6
Novice: Radcliffe 6:48.3; NU 7:12.5; BU 7:31.7
